If you've seen those incredible, glowing eye looks at festivals, parties, or on social media, chances are you've encountered this magical product. So, what exactly is a UV Water Activated Liner? In simple terms, it's a type of eyeliner (or body paint, as it's often versatile enough for both) that comes in a solid, pressed cake form. The 'water activated' part means you need to add a small amount of liquid, usually water, to the product to transform it into a creamy, workable consistency. This makes it incredibly easy to control and apply with a brush, giving you crisp lines and bold shapes. Now, for the 'UV' aspect – this is where the real fun begins! These liners are formulated with special pigments that react to ultraviolet (UV) light, also known as blacklight. This means that while they might look like vibrant, opaque colors in regular lighting, they truly come alive and glow intensely when exposed to a UV light source. These liners are fantastic for anyone looking to push the boundaries of their creativity. They're a staple for festival-goers, performers, or anyone who loves a unique, eye-catching look. Unlike some glow-in-the-dark products, UV liners don't need to be 'charged' by light; they simply glow when UV light is present. And because they're water activated, they're generally easy to remove with just water and a gentle cleanser, which is a huge plus after a long night out. When choosing your UV Water Activated Liner, look for brands that offer a wide range of intense, opaque colors. Some formulas are better than others for consistency and vibrancy. Always do a small patch test if you have sensitive skin, though most are formulated to be safe for face and body.
